Vantage is commencing the second phase of development at its 55MW EU campus (FRA1) in Frankfurt, Germany. Located in Offenbach, this second phase will see the construction of a 16MW capacity, 13,000 square meters (140,000 square feet) facility, which will be operational in the first half of 2024....

NextDC has announced its plans to develop a data center in Adelaide, Australia. The Australian data center firm revealed that it had purchased land to develop a 10MW data center which will be called A1 Adelaide. The facility will be a Tier IV-certified data center.
